Output 65e714e7f9ff72f99092185f88198d9f0d62a8c3ac6666a038d6802a5cb5cb68:2

value
37268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ba94dee0eceaaec7cf7e2848f4e1ebfdfe137345 OP_EQUAL
address
3JhZwwFdCvCgmnseN2WjdpAnqhZWJg7jJK
transaction
65e714e7f9ff72f99092185f88198d9f0d62a8c3ac6666a038d6802a5cb5cb68
confirmations
263291
spent
true